Mercedes is expecting to be back fighting with the likes of Ferrari, Aston Martin, and Alpine in the Canadian GP, which says will be a 'bigger challenge' for its F1 car.

scored a double podium after the Brackley team's comprehensive upgrade package delivered a solid step forward., Mercedes' W14 was the second-strongest car on the high-downforce circuit, providing the team with a solid baseline to continue its recovery.above Aston Martin to second place in the constructors' standings.

"The fact is that the update kit works very well around circuits like Barcelona with a lot of high-speed performance," Shovlin said in Mercedes' post-race debrief on Wednesday. "Now, where we are going to go next week, Montreal, it's a very different circuit. There are more low-speed corners, quite a lot of straight-line full throttle and we would expect more of a challenge there.
